Company segments can be used to define divisions or sections of a company. Segment level information appears at the top of the Mobility Details screen and is mostly used to place mobility records in certain regions/departments/cost centers/office locations/divisions, etc.
Depending on the Mobility Type, up to four levels can be selected on the Company Segment Levels screen. These levels can be defined as either text boxes (free text option) or as a lookup based on a predefined list of values.
In addition, if one or more segments are ticked under the Segment Access Security section on the Company Segment Levels screen, to view the assignment record the user must have access to the segment level and the to/from country as per the configuration on the User Maintenance Screen (Company Segment Security & Country Security tabs).
Company segments can be used for the following reasons:
Reporting
Segment Levels can be used to categorize assignment records e.g. Region, Office Location, Cost Center or Group. These 'categories' in turn can then be used to effectively report on the assignment files for instance you can report on how many employees are currently working in the United Kingdom office's engineering department.
Widgets (Visual reporting)
For widgets, segment levels can be used to show how many people are moving between regions or divisions or expand even more to look at the ratio of men and women moving to the region or division.
Security/Access
A user’s access to the company can be restricted by the defined company segments or levels. Users can only view assignments that are moving from or to the segments to which they have rights. This security is defined at the user level on the User Maintenance screen on the Company Segment Security tab by configuring whether to grant or deny access to each of the segment levels.
Things to Note
To and From Segment level availability depends on the Mobility Type of the record
